North America is likely to see higher demand for hydrogen energy storage dueto increased use of hydrogen gas in oil refineries andchemical industries in the region. In addition, stricter regulations and increasedfuel cell activity are likely to encourage the growth of a hydrogen energystorage market.

Increasing applications of hydrogen across severalsectors is a main driver for hydrogen energy storage market. Growing demand forproducing hydrogen from electrolysis using surplus renewable power is also adriver for the hydrogen energy storage market. Declining cost of renewablepower generation from solar and wind energy is also an opportunity for thegrowth of hydrogen energy storage market. Stored hydrogen demand in severalend-use applications including fuel cell vehicles, grid services, andtelecommunication services is also an opportunity for the market.

The low density of hydrogen is a challenge for hydrogenenergy storage market. However, high capital cost of hydrogen storage andgrowing investment in the battery technology is a restraint in growth ofhydrogen energy storage market during the forecast period of 2021-2028.

In July 2018, Air Liquide and the Chinese startup STNE(Shanghai Sinotran New Energy Automobile Operation CO., LTD.), have signed anagreement to expedite the rollout of hydrogen-powered electric truck fleets inChina. Air Liquide has provided STNE with its expertise in the intact hydrogensupply chain, from production and storage to distribution, to stimulate thestartup’s development. STNE intends to operate a fleet of up to 7,500 trucksand to operate a network of around 25 hydrogen stations by 2020.
